An FHA loan is a mortgage loan that’s backed by the Federal Housing Administration. Borrowers are required to pay a mortgage insurance premium, which reduces the lender’s risk if a borrower defaults.

Reverse mortgages are increasing in popularity with seniors who have equity in their homes and want to supplement their income. The only reverse mortgage insured by the U.S. Federal Government is called a Home Equity Conversion Mortgage (HECM), and is only available through an FHA-approved lender.

FHA loan regulations require borrowers to wait a minimum of two years before applying for a new FHA mortgage after Chapter 7 bankruptcy. fha loans are a good choice for home purchase and refinance loans..
